Flexible warehousing refers to a logistics model where businesses can rent storage space on a short-term, pay-as-you-go basis. Unlike traditional warehouses that require multi-year leases and fixed square footage, flexible warehousing allows you to scale up or down quickly based on real-time demand. Imagine you’re launching a new product line. With flexible warehousing, you can secure additional storage space within days, not months. When demand drops, you can downsize just as easily. This agility is crucial for maintaining cash flow and avoiding overstocking.
By integrating with fulfillment networks, flexible warehousing often includes value-added services like pick-and-pack, labeling, and shipping. This means you can move inventory closer to your customers without the hassle of managing multiple facilities. Economic uncertainty or market shifts can render a long-term warehouse lease a liability. Flexible warehousing allows you to test new markets or handle temporary spikes without committing to permanent infrastructure. This is especially relevant for businesses that rely on global supply chains.
